Amperage Control
Amperage control is a critical feature in a welding machine, especially for beginners. Amperage refers to the electrical current that flows through the weld joint, and it plays a significant role in determining the quality of the weld. A welding machine with adjustable amperage control allows beginners to fine-tune their welding settings and achieve the ideal arc length, penetration, and weld quality. This feature is particularly useful for beginners, as it enables them to experiment with different welding techniques and settings to achieve the desired results.
A welding machine with amperage control typically has a range of settings that can be adjusted to suit different welding applications. Some machines may have a more advanced amperage control system, which allows for fine-tuning of the settings in increments, such as in 1-amp increments. This level of precision can be particularly useful for beginners who are trying to master different welding techniques.

Power Source
The power source of a welding machine refers to the electrical energy that powers the weld arc. The type of power source used in a welding machine can significantly impact the performance and quality of the weld. Common power sources for welding machines include AC, DC, and mixed AC/DC.
When choosing a welding machine for beginners, it is essential to select a machine with a power source that is suitable for the type of welding being performed. For example, AC power is commonly used for shielded metal arc welding (SMAW), while DC power is often used for gas metal arc welding (GMAW). Mixed AC/DC power sources are also available, which can provide a combination of the benefits offered by both AC and DC power.
Safety Features
Safety features are a critical consideration when selecting a welding machine for beginners. Welding can be a hazardous process, and a welding machine with inadequate safety features can increase the risk of accidents or injuries. Essential safety features to consider in a welding machine for beginners include:
- Overheat protection to prevent the machine from overheating and causing damage or injury.
- Short circuit protection to prevent electrical shocks and injuries.
- Metal fume extraction to reduce the risk of respiratory problems and eye irritation.
- Safety interlocks to prevent accidental start-up or operation of the machine.
These safety features can help ensure that beginners use their welding machine safely and effectively, reducing the risk of accidents and injuries.

Safety Precautions and Best Practices for Welding Machine Use
When working with a welding machine, it’s essential to prioritize your safety and take necessary precautions to prevent accidents and injuries. Proper safety equipment, a safe workspace, and correct welding technique are crucial in ensuring a successful and accident-free welding experience.
Necessary Safety Equipment for Welding
When engaging in welding activities, it’s vital to wear the right safety gear to protect yourself from the heat, sparks, and radiation generated by the welding process. Some of the essential safety equipment you’ll need include:
- Welding helmet or goggles to protect your eyes from the intense heat and radiation generated by the welding arc
- Heat-resistant gloves to prevent burns and damage to your hands
- Fire-resistant clothing to protect your skin from sparks and heat
- Steel-toed shoes or safety boots to prevent foot injuries
- A face shield or mask to protect your face and respiratory system from sparks and fumes
A well-equipped workspace is as crucial as the right safety gear. When setting up your workspace, ensure that it’s well-ventilated, free from flammable materials, and has adequate lighting. A clean and organized workspace will also prevent accidents and injuries.
Proper Welding Technique and Posture
Proper welding technique and posture are vital in preventing injuries and ensuring a high-quality weld. When welding, maintain good posture by standing comfortably with your back straight and feet shoulder-width apart. Hold the welding torch at a comfortable distance from your body and keep your hands and arms relaxed. Avoid leaning forward or backward, as this can put unnecessary strain on your back and neck.
Common Welding Hazards and Prevention Methods
Welding can be a hazardous activity if not done properly. Some common hazards associated with welding include:
- Fumes and sparks: These can cause respiratory problems and eye injuries if not properly contained.
- Electric shock: Improper use of electrical equipment can cause electric shock and electrocution.
- Burns: Inadequate safety gear and improper technique can cause severe burns.
- Sparked fires: Sparks can ignite nearby flammable materials, causing fires.
To prevent these hazards, ensure that:
* You wear the necessary safety gear, including a helmet or goggles, gloves, and fire-resistant clothing.
* Your workspace is well-ventilated and free from flammable materials.
* You use high-quality electrical equipment and follow proper electrical safety procedures.
* You keep a fire extinguisher nearby and know how to use it.
* You stay alert and focused during the welding process and take regular breaks to avoid fatigue.
